Understanding Climate Change and Its Global Impact

Climate change refers to the long-term alteration of temperature and typical weather patterns in a place, primarily driven by human activities such as burning fossil fuels, deforestation, and industrial processes. As outlined by the Intergovernmental Panel on Climate Change (IPCC), these activities have significantly increased greenhouse gas (GHG) concentrations in the atmosphere, leading to global warming. The year 2025 marks a critical juncture, with governments realizing that unchecked climatic shifts can lead to catastrophic impacts: rising sea levels displacing coastal communities, increased frequency and severity of natural disasters, and disrupted agricultural systems threatening food security. These transformations highlight the necessity for international cooperation to build a resilient global society.

The repercussions of climate change are felt universally, underscoring a shared responsibility among nations to navigate its challenges collaboratively. Countries that emit the most greenhouse gases often contribute to adverse effects impacting poorer, less industrialized nations disproportionately. For instance, low-lying island nations face existential threats from rising sea levels, while arid regions confront severe droughts and water shortages. Consequently, the climate crisis transcends borders—solving it requires comprehensive, coordinated responses from multiple stakeholders, including governments, businesses, and civil society.

The Role of International Agreements in Climate Action

International agreements play a vital role in fostering cooperation among nations in response to climate change. The Paris Agreement, adopted in 2015, represents a significant milestone, uniting countries in their commitment to limit global warming to well below 2 degrees Celsius above pre-industrial levels, with aspirations to further restrict the increase to 1.5 degrees Celsius. As of 2025, nearly all nations have submitted their updated Nationally Determined Contributions (NDCs), representing a comprehensive approach to achieving emission reduction targets. The collaborative framework established by the Paris Agreement promotes transparency, accountability, and ongoing dialogue, thereby reinforcing the foundation for global partnership.

Additionally, initiatives like the United Nations Framework Convention on Climate Change (UNFCCC) have facilitated robust mechanisms for knowledge-sharing, enabling countries to learn from one another’s experiences and successes. These agreements allow nations to pool resources, share technologies, and collaborate on innovative solutions tailored to their specific contexts. As the challenges posed by climate change continue to evolve, adaptive international structures will be essential in ensuring that communities can respond cohesively and effectively.

Success Stories of International Cooperation in Climate Change Mitigation

Success stories abound in the arena of international cooperation aimed at climate change mitigation. One of the most exemplary cases is the Green Climate Fund (GCF), designed to assist developing countries in transitioning to low-emission and climate-resilient development. Notably, this initiative has successfully mobilized billions of dollars in funding, allowing nations to implement sustainable practices in sectors such as renewable energy, sustainable agriculture, and forest conservation. By pooling financial resources on a global scale, the GCF exemplifies how cohesive efforts can catalyze climatic resilience in vulnerable regions.

Another prominent example is the collaborative work of the Global Methane Initiative (GMI), which focuses on reducing methane emissions—a potent greenhouse gas twenty-five times more effective than carbon dioxide over a century. Launched in 2004, GMI unites countries, industry leaders, and organizations to implement cost-effective, surface-level strategies that alleviate methane emissions from waste management, agriculture, and fossil fuel production. By leveraging shared knowledge and best practices, partner countries can expedite progress toward reduction targets while promoting economic development.

Moreover, the Coalition for Rainforest Nations has successfully advocated for the recognition of the invaluable role forests play in carbon sequestration. By creating the REDD+ framework, nations can work cooperatively to incentivize sustainable land use management, preserving the world’s tropical forests. This initiative not only contributes to climate mitigation efforts but also supports indigenous communities and biodiversity, demonstrating how international cooperation can yield multifaceted benefits beyond mere carbon reduction.

The Importance of Technological Collaboration

Technology plays a pivotal role in addressing climate change, and international collaborations in research and development have become critical in this context. As of 2025, countries are increasingly recognizing the importance of investing in clean technologies, ranging from renewable energy sources like solar and wind to innovations in energy efficiency and carbon capture and storage. These technological advancements require significant upfront investments; thus, international partnerships can help distribute costs and knowledge more equitably among countries.

For example, the Mission Innovation initiative, launched in conjunction with the 2015 Paris Agreement, brings together governments and private sectors to accelerate public and private clean energy innovation. By setting ambitious investment goals, countries can mobilize funding for research while simultaneously creating networks of collaboration that foster intellectual property sharing. Through such initiatives, nations can pave the way for breakthroughs that enable rapid scaling of essential technologies to combat climate change.

Moreover, partnerships between industrialized and developing nations enable technology transfer that is vital for empowering emerging economies. Initiatives such as the Clean Development Mechanism (CDM) provide a framework for investment in sustainable infrastructure in developing countries. By facilitating access to advanced technologies, developing nations can reduce their emissions while still pursuing economic growth, showing how successful collaboration can uplift entire communities.

Future Directions for Global Cooperation on Climate Action

Looking beyond 2025, the future of global cooperation on climate change is poised for transformation. With climate-related disasters causing significant human displacement, nations must prioritize enhanced collaboration, particularly regarding climate refugees. As more people find themselves forced to leave their homes due to environmental factors, countries will need to establish frameworks that not only provide aid but also facilitate legal protections for displaced individuals. International agreements on climate migration will be imperative in fostering a comprehensive response to this emerging reality.

In addition, greater emphasis will likely be placed on nature-based solutions (NbS) as countries seek sustainable pathways for climate mitigation. NbS involve the conservation and restoration of natural ecosystems, allowing for carbon sequestration while simultaneously protecting biodiversity. By investing in NbS, nations can build resilience to climate impacts while promoting socio-economic development. For collective implementation to be successful, global frameworks that incentivize investments in NbS will need to be established.

Finally, enhancing public engagement in climate action will be crucial to garnering widespread support for cooperative initiatives. As climate change awareness grows, more communities are expressing a desire to be involved in decision-making processes. Governments will need to create enabling environments for citizens, civil organizations, and local stakeholders to collaborate effectively. Transparent communication and education efforts can motivate individuals to advocate for climate action collectively, further reinforcing the necessity of international cooperation.
